Search our geolocation database.
Enter your Search Pattern
51417818, 28, Flat 7, Forest Road, London, E8 3bl,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
51417819, 28, Flat 8, Forest Road, London, E8 3bl,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
51417820, 28, Flat 9, Forest Road, London, E8 3bl,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
51436116, 42, Flat 1, Forest Road, London, E8 3bl,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
51436117, 42, Flat 2, Forest Road, London, E8 3bl, Greater London,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
